Get in TouchThe Honda repair market for Gray, Maine, and its immediate vicinity is characterized by a mix of local independents and regional chains, with the nearest Honda dealership located a short drive away in Saco. The overall quality is high, with several shops boasting excellent reputations and long tenures. **Competition Level:** Moderate. There is no shortage of general repair shops, but true Honda specialists with specific expertise in systems like VTEC, SH-AWD, and Hybrids are concentrated at the dealership level (Prime Honda) or within a select few highly-rated independents (Gray Corner Garage). This specialization creates a tiered market. **Typical Pricing:** Pricing follows a clear tier structure. Dealership labor rates are at the premium end, reflecting factory training and proprietary tools. Top-tier independents like Gray Corner Garage are typically slightly more affordable than the dealer while still commanding a premium for expertise. Regional chains like VIP offer the most budget-friendly labor rates for standard maintenance and common repairs. For complex issues, the higher investment at a specialist often proves more cost-effective in the long run.

Given Maine's harsh winters, we frequently address rust-related brake line and suspension component issues, as well as problems stemming from potholes on routes like Route 100 or 202. Honda models like the CR-V and Accord also commonly need attention for worn CV joints from gravel driveways and early brake pad wear from stop-and-go traffic in town.

Prioritize undercarriage washes during winter to combat road salt corrosion on your Honda's frame and components. It's also wise to have your suspension and alignment checked seasonally due to rough local road conditions, and to use a shop that understands the specific service intervals for Honda models commonly driven in our variable New England climate.
